Output 255c93614d4a45deb9bfd15a5f47c3656873af21db6d43071a81e6c8384700c6:8

value
166977
script pubkey
OP_0 OP_PUSHBYTES_20 ccf99ddbdc646b9455e37b0727751c080baeff53
address
bc1qenuemk7uv34eg40r0vrjwagupq96al6nzkaq0m
transaction
255c93614d4a45deb9bfd15a5f47c3656873af21db6d43071a81e6c8384700c6
spent
true